Event Details
The Georgia Tech Symphony Orchestra will be starting off its second concert of the semester with Louise Farrenc’s powerful and dramatic first overture. This is followed by a performance of Elgar’s renowned Cello Concerto featuring Eric Chen, winner of the 2022 GTSO Concerto Competition. Finally, the orchestra will be playing Dvořák’s Seventh Symphony, a monumental work that is filled with references to the Czech composer’s homeland and is regarded by many critics as the greatest of his nine symphonies.
